2007 (Fr.): Saw action as a backup linebacker and special teams player... Recorded 14 tackles on the season... Had three tackles against Southeastern Louisiana and vs. Florida International... Had two tackles against both Iowa State and Missouri. 2006 (RS): Redshirted the season. High School: Named All-State as a senior by the Oklahoma Coaches Association and the Daily Oklahoman... Named All-Area Defensive Player of the Year and the 2A-4A District Player of the Year in 2005... Helped the team to the 2A state championship in 2004 and a runner-up finish in 3A during the 2003 season... Led the team with 174 tackles as a senior... Carried the ball for more than 1,000 yards and scored 31 touchdowns as a senior... Collected 162 tackles as a junior and 151 stops as a sophomore... Broke the school record with 487 career tackles... Coached in football by Jim Dixon... Lettered in football, power lifting, baseball and track for the Bulldogs... His team won the state baseball championship his junior season...A state power lifting champion as a junior and senior and member of the state's best 4x100 relay team in 2005... A member of National Honor Society and Oklahoma Honor Society. Personal: Born in Sulphur, Okla... Major is psychology... Plans to attend dental school after graduation... Hobbies include spending time with friends... Son of Deneen and Alvern Gulla and Randy Lewis... Has one brother and two sisters.
